| GET /api/v2/pay/verify_transactions |
| Header name | Description |
|---|---|
|
Cookie required |
Login session cookie |
|
Provision required |
Web/Mobile/API Provision UUID |
| Param name | Description |
|---|---|
|
donor_guid required |
guid of the donor Validations:
|
|
account_schedule_guid required |
guid of the recurring setup Validations:
|
verify transaction
| Param name | Description |
|---|---|
|
data required |
verify transaction Validations:
|
|
data[id] required |
ID of the verify transaction Validations:
|
|
data[type] required |
Type of record Validations:
|
|
data[attributes] required |
Attributes of the verify transaction Validations:
|
|
data[attributes][AccountScheduleGUID] required |
GUID of the account schedule Validations:
|
|
data[attributes][DonorGUID] required |
guid of the donor Validations:
|
|
data[attributes][AccountGUID] required |
guid of the account Validations:
|
|
data[attributes][AccountScheduleStatus] required |
status of the recurring setup Validations:
|
|
data[attributes][Amount] required |
amount donated Validations:
|
|
data[attributes][ScheduledDate] required |
next recurring date Validations:
|
|
data[attributes][RecurringType] required |
type of the recurring setup Validations:
|
|
data[attributes][Quantity] required |
number of recurring setups Validations:
|
|
data[attributes][RecurringName] required |
type name of the recurring setup Validations:
|
|
data[attributes][Memo] required |
recurring setup memo Validations:
|
|
data[attributes][InvoiceNumber] required |
empty Validations:
|
|
data[attributes][CustomerTransactionID] required |
empty Validations:
|
|
data[attributes][UserDefinedData1] required |
empty Validations:
|
|
data[attributes][UserDefinedData2] required |
empty Validations:
|
|
data[attributes][UserDefinedData3] required |
empty Validations:
|
|
data[attributes][TransactionGUID] required |
guid of the transaction Validations:
|
|
data[attributes][TransactionDate] required |
date of the transaction Validations:
|
|
data[attributes][SettlementDate] required |
deposit date Validations:
|
|
data[attributes][TransactionStatus] required |
status of the transaction Validations:
|
|
data[attributes][ResponseCode] required |
transaction response code Validations:
|
|
data[attributes][ResponseCodeDescr] required |
transaction id of the customer Validations:
|
|
data[attributes][ResponseCodeAVS] required |
user defined data Validations:
|
|
data[attributes][FileID] required |
user defined data Validations:
|
|
data[attributes][designation_information] required |
Attributes of the designation_information Validations:
|
|
data[attributes][designation_information][DesignationID] required |
designation id Validations:
|
|
data[attributes][designation_information][DesignationGUID] required |
designation guid Validations:
|
|
data[attributes][designation_information][DesignationName] required |
designation name Validations:
|
|
data[attributes][designation_information][DesignationAmount] required |
designation amount Validations:
|
|
data[attributes][designation_information][DesignationAllocationID] required |
id of the designation allocation Validations:
|
|
data[attributes][designation_information][designationmemo] required |
designation memo Validations:
|
Unauthorized
| Param name | Description |
|---|---|
|
errors required |
Errors returned by request Validations:
|
|
errors[error] required |
Why the request failed Validations:
|
|
errors[status] required |
HTTP response code Validations:
|
Not Found
| Param name | Description |
|---|---|
|
errors required |
Errors returned by request Validations:
|
|
errors[error] required |
Why the request failed Validations:
|
|
errors[status] required |
HTTP response code Validations:
|
Unprocessable Entity
| Param name | Description |
|---|---|
|
errors required |
Errors returned by request Validations:
|
|
errors[error] required |
Why the request failed Validations:
|
|
errors[status] required |
HTTP response code Validations:
|
Internal Server Error
| Param name | Description |
|---|---|
|
errors required |
Errors returned by request Validations:
|
|
errors[error] required |
Why the request failed Validations:
|
|
errors[status] required |
HTTP response code Validations:
|
| Code | Description |
|---|---|
| 404 | Data source query failed |
| 422 | Invalid parameter(s) |
| 422 | Provision header missing |
| 422 | Invalid provision |
| 422 | Under maintenance |
| 422 | Incorrect host for provision |
| 422 | Establishing session failed |
| 422 | Privilege to perform the action was not found |
| 422 | Not logged in |
| 422 | Provision does not match logged in provision |
| 500 | No connection to data source |